Before we even get into side dishes, selecting the right tuna is crucial. Whether you prefer Ahi, Yellowfin, or Bluefin, freshness is paramount. Tuna should have a mild scent of the ocean, and the flesh should be vibrant in color, firm to the touch, and free of any discoloration. Seasoning is equally important. A simple blend of salt, pepper, and a drizzle of olive oil can elevate the fish’s natural flavors. For an Asian twist, consider a marinade with soy sauce, sesame oil, and ginger.

Salads can bring a refreshing contrast to the richness of tuna. Here are some ideas:
To create a spicy Asian cucumber salad, slice cucumbers and toss them with rice vinegar, sesame oil, and chili flakes. Add sesame seeds and cilantro for extra flavor. This light dish will offer a refreshing crunch alongside your tuna steak.
Vegetables can provide a satisfying accompaniment, especially when roasted or grilled. Consider these options:
To prepare grilled asparagus, simply toss the spears with olive oil, salt, and pepper, then grill until tender. Finish with a squeeze of lemon juice for a bright touch that complements the tuna.
Grains can add a comforting element to your meal. Here are some great choices:
Cook quinoa according to package instructions, and once cooked, fluff it with a fork. Mix in fresh herbs like parsley and mint, along with lemon juice and zest for a refreshing side.
Dips and sauces can transform your meal into a flavorful experience. Here are a few ideas:
To prepare wasabi mashed potatoes, boil potatoes until tender, then mash them with butter, cream, and a touch of wasabi paste. The heat of the wasabi will cut through the creaminess and enhance the tuna's flavor.
